Santa Welcomed at South Rosemary School, Dec. 24, 1920

South Rosemary School has been frequently visited by Santa Claus during the last week. He left five beautifully decorated Christmas trees. The Christmas tree for the High School was deposited in the auditorium on Monday evening at 8 o’clock, each member of the High School had invited a guest and had made plans for entertaining them. Oranges, nuts and candy were served. Many parents and friends were present at the first grade Christmas tree on Tuesday afternoon. Santa Claus surprised each little first grader with a bright colored stocking filled with nuts and fruit and candy. A Christmas play was presented by the primary department. (From the Roanoke Rapids Herald, Dec. 24, 1920)
